Hello, recently purchased a 1981 KZ305 CSR with what appears all original parts. Obviously the fuel lines, carb vent and fuel lines, etc. are all toast and hard and need replacing. I have a digital copy of the maintenance manual, but am having a very hard time locating the inner diameter (ID) of any of the lines for this bike. Is anyone able to provide this info? Realize, the OEM fuel hose is thin and stretchy. Totally different from car fuel line, which is thick, and has an internal, no stretch, woven casing inside, to keep the hose from expanding under high pressure. Car fuel line typically comes in english fractional sizes also, like 1/4" and 5/16" size. This type of fuel hose requires a clamp, whereas the stretchy OEM stuff doesn't.
If you have some calipers, I strongly suggest measuring the hose at the carb inlet Tee. If the measurement suggests 7mm ID hose, this Suzuki hose is the best I've found. As a bonus, they provide about 5' of the stuff, so you can have lots of spare hanging around, which is quite useful.

You have the smaller size, 5.5 X 6.4ishmm. A couple companies dominated the Petcock market back then, Mikuni or Taiyo Giken as supplied thru various brands. I'm betting you have the TG product. Ed is Correct for the Suzuki Hose but it only fits the Larger 7mm style barbs. If you're not concerned with a splash of color, use 1/4' Tygon fuel line. Readily available at "most" hardware/lawn mower shops. Like the hose Ed mentioned and original, it's thin-walled so assembly won't be a fight. It also is a friction fit but would suggest some sort of clamp. Tygon shrinks as it ages, contrary to what most person's don't care to admit.
